D-Wave Quantum Inc. Soars on Wall Street

D-Wave Quantum Inc. experienced a significant boost in stock value, seeing an impressive rise of 6.9% in trading this Monday. The stock reached as high as $10.45 before settling at $9.77, surpassing its previous close of $9.14. Even though the trading volume was 41,465,284 shares, it marked a 23% decrease from the average session, reflecting a robust interest in the company’s potential.

Analysts Back D-Wave With Optimism

Multiple analysts have recently raised their target prices for D-Wave Quantum, showing increased confidence in its trajectory. Among them, Roth Mkm elevated its target price from $3.00 to $7.00, while Craig Hallum adjusted its target to $9.00, emphasizing their positive outlook on the company’s prospects. B. Riley and Benchmark also lifted their valuations, affirming a “buy” status for the stock. Collectively, experts have issued a consensus “Buy” rating, with an average price goal of $5.63.

Institutional Interest and Insider Moves

Significant insider activity was noted with a major shareholder selling over 8 million shares, amidst changing institutional interests. Companies such as Thoroughbred Financial Services LLC and SG Americas Securities LLC have acquired new stakes, signaling increased institutional involvement.

About D-Wave Quantum Inc.

Renowned for its pioneering work in quantum computing, D-Wave offers cutting-edge systems and solutions globally. Products like Advantage, a fifth-generation quantum computer, and the Ocean software suite are central to its innovative offerings.
